Most Searched Technical Colleges In Missouri: Student Population Comparison

For the academic year 2022-2023, the total student population of Most Searched Technical Colleges In Missouri is 39,152.

The proportion of undergraduate students is 62.59% (24,507 students) and graduate students's proportion is 37.41% (14,645 graduate students).

Washington University in St Louis has the most students of 17,012 among Most Searched Technical Colleges In Missouri. By gender, the male-female ratio at Most Searched Technical Colleges In Missouri is 44.89% (17,575 male students) to 55.11% (21,577 female students).
